The area of a circle is 220 cm2. The area of ta square inscribed in it is

विकल्प

  • 49 cm2

  • 70 cm2

  •  140 cm2

  •  150 cm

MCQ

उत्तर

Let BD be the diameter and diagonal of the circle and the square respectively.

We know that area of the circle `=pir^2`

Area of the circle  =`pir^2`

`∴ 220=22/7xxr^2`

Multiplying both sides of the equation by 7 we get, 

`220xx7=22xxr^2`

Dividing both sides of the equation by 22 we get,

`∴ r^2=70`

`∴r=sqrt70`

As we know that diagonal of the square is the diameter of the square.

`∴ "Diagonal"=2r`

`∴ "Diagonal"=2sqrt70`

`∴ "side of the square"= "diagonal"/sqrt2`   ................(1)

Substituting Diagonal=`2sqrt70` in equation (1) we get,

side of the square=`(2sqrt70)/2`

∴ side of the square= `2sqrt(70/2)`

∴ side of the square=`2sqrt35`

∴ Area of the square=`"side "^2`

                                 =`(2sqrt35)^2`

                                 =`4xx35`

                                 = `140`

Therefore, area of the square is.`140 cm^2`
